React switch case jsx
WebReact switch case in class components example. Switch expressions is never used in return expression inside jsx render. However, We can use the switch expression either in a … Web但是,当项目的代码量足够大并且有很多JSX条件时,事情很快就会失控。过多的 if 语句会导致组件混乱,因此,我们可以将多个条件提取到包含 switch 语句的单独组件中。如果我们需要根据用户的不同状态显示Foo、Bar、Default三个组件,枚举会比if语句更优雅。
React switch case jsx
Did you know?
WebSep 19, 2024 · Step 1: Create a React application using the following command: npx create-react-app name_of_the_app. Step 2: After creating the react application move to the directory as per your app name using the following command: cd name_of_the_app. Project Structure: It will look like the following. Creating the JSX Element: Now we are going to … WebJun 11, 2024 · It's greatly beneficial to be able to use plain JavaScript within our React components. But if you want even more declarative and straightforward conditionals, check out the React library JSX control statements. You can bring it into your React projects by running the following command: npm install --save-dev babel-plugin-jsx-control-statements
WebSep 24, 2024 · React Switch Case Operator Example In this step, we are going to learn how to use switch case conditional statement in React JSX. Let’s understand what switch statement is; it allows us to perform various actions based on multiple choices. As you can see, we are trying to find out the current day based on JavaScript’s new Date method. WebDec 6, 2024 · Summary. The switch statement is one of the most useful features of JavaScript. It is perfect for setting up conditions and returning a specific value depending …
Web1 day ago · const initialState = { noOfIceCream: 100 } export const iceCreamReducer = (state = initialState, action) => { switch (action.type) { case ICE_CREAM_BUY: console.log ... WebMar 2, 2024 · Here, we have demonstrated the most common example of a switch statement. It will print a particular output based on the value of the variable and in this …
WebJul 5, 2024 · reactjs switch-statement conditional-rendering 32,350 Solution 1 Directly it's not allowed, because we can't put any statement inside JSX. You can do one thing, put the code (switch logic) inside a function and call that function, and return the correct component from that. Check doc for: Embedding Expressions in JSX Like this:
WebJan 16, 2024 · In JSX - the syntax extension used for React - you can use plain JavaScript which includes if else statements, ternary operators, switch case statements, and much more. In a conditional render, a React … iq bot workflowWebJul 5, 2024 · reactjs switch-statement conditional-rendering 32,350 Solution 1 Directly it's not allowed, because we can't put any statement inside JSX. You can do one thing, put the … iq bow lightWebSep 29, 2024 · In react native we can use the switch case statement to match the given value from user and according to them execute the condition or function. Switch case compare the value with each present case, if the matched case found then it will execute its code of block and if none of case matches then it will by default execute the default case. iq bot - robot iq optionWebAround 9+ years of IT experience which includes 5+years of Extensive experience as a React JS Full Stack Developer and 4 years of experience as a UI Developer. Experience in all phase of SDLC like ... orchid body salon washington paWebAug 25, 2024 · As you might know, React has JSX markup that often we need to implement conditional logic for component there. However, we can’t use common “if else” or “switch case” statement directly in JSX. In JSX, we should use other conditional rendering methods like the ternary operator and && operator. Here, we are going to discuss this more details. iq brain blitz scamWebSwitch Case operator in React Interestingly, we can write switch case inline just like normal Javascript for conditional rendering in React. However, you would need a self-invoking JavaScript function. Take a look at the implementation below. orchid body salonWebMay 27, 2024 · We can use switch statements inside a React component as we do with plain JavaScript. For instance, we can write: import React from "react"; const Foo = ( { val }) => { switch (val) { case "bar": return "bar"; default: return "foo"; } }; export default function App () { return ( <> ); } orchid body wash